Ticket #FAC-4407 — Turnstile upgrade, Quarrington Plaza lobby

Hi folks, heads up that Stilegate Systems are in from Tuesday to refit the main lobby turnstiles. Expect a bit of noise and one lane out of action at a time — apologies in advance! Please wave staff toward whichever lane has the green light, and keep visitors to the manual gate by the desk. While the readers are offline, the manual gate keypad will accept the temporary code below:

door code, yagap-bahof: bdg-O-05

## SpoolPilot Environments

Quick refresher before you review the env-promotion PR: SpoolPilot (our printer-spooler microservice) runs in three tiers — dev, staging, and prod — and each tier talks to a different queue broker. Dev is fine to break; staging mirrors prod traffic from the Kestrelwood office fleet at roughly 10%. The only real gotcha is that retry backoff differs per tier, so diff carefully. Here are the current staging values.

settings of fafog-haduf:
ZORIX_PIN=4648
ZORIX_METRICS_HOST=metrics.zorix.paliqsys.corp
ZORIX_LOG_LEVEL=info
ZORIX_TENANT=druix

## Who to Contact — GridWeaver Crossword Generator

Building a plugin for GridWeaver? Great — welcome aboard. For anything related to the clue-generation API or grid-fill hooks, the Puzzles Platform team at Lanternfish Labs is your first stop. They own the plugin SDK, review new extension proposals, and run the monthly office hours where most integration questions get sorted out fast. Don't sit on a weird fill bug for days; they'd rather hear about it early. Drop the team a line at the address below.

pager mailbox: praix@zarqelstack.internal

Hey — quick one before you review PR 412: the Quibbletree invoice renderer's font vault locked itself again after the deploy, so the PDF snapshots in CI are all Helvetica fallbacks. Re-run the suite after unlocking it. The vault accepts the recovery passphrase listed just below this note.

unlock words, yawig-kagef: gordor-holvan-ulaael-pramir-ulaiel-tamdor